There are both outpatient and inpatient drug and alcohol rehab, but there are a few types of outpatient drug and alcohol rehab in Crystal Lake from which to choose. Regular outpatient care is minimally invasive and clients can usually participate in counseling and therapy a few times a week. Intensive outpatient rehabs provide counseling and therapy similar to regular outpatient, but on a more accelerated schedule which also accommodates family and work life.
One outpatient drug treatment type called Day Treatment or Partial Hospitalization is said to be the most comprehensive type of outpatient treatment out there. Individuals can still go home or to a sober living facility at the end of each day, but will spend the majority of the day involved in outpatient rehab services. Day treatment and partial hospitalization outpatient drug and alcohol treatment is perfect for individuals who have newly gone through an inpatient rehab, but still need to keep a strong system of support while they become more comfortable with a sober lifestyle. These programs also usually offer a wider array of services that normal outpatient may not offer, including alternative therapies, medication management, and dual-diagnosis treatment.
It is common for individuals in outpatient drug or alcohol treatment or after rehab in outpatient alcohol and drug treatment to relapse. In these cases inpatient treatment would correctly be the next step.
